<br />202.20 202.20 (Rev. 7/09) <br /> <br /> <br />202.20: CHARGES FOR EMERGENCY SERVICES; COLLECTION; <br />COLLECTION OF UNPAID SERVICE CHARGES AND FEES; COLLECTION OF <br />UNPAID ADMINISTRATIVE OFFENSE PENALTIES: (Added, Ord. 822, 7-2-09) <br /> <br />Subd. 1. Authority: This Section is adopted pursuant to Minnesota Statutes, Sections <br />415.01, 366.011, and 366.012 and Section 8.06 of the City Charter. (Added, <br />Ord. 822, 7-2-09) <br /> <br />Subd. 2. Charges for Emergency Services; Collection: The City may impose a reasonable <br />service charge for emergency services, including fire, rescue, medical, and related <br />services provided by the City or contracted for by the City. If the service charge remains <br />unpaid thirty (30) days after a notice of delinquency is sent to the recipient of the service <br />or the recipient’s representative or estate, the City or its contractor on behalf of the City <br />may use any lawful means allowed to a private party for the collection of an unsecured <br />delinquent debt. The City may also use the authority of Section 202.20, subdivision 3, to <br />collect unpaid service charges of this kind from delinquent recipients of services who are <br />owners of taxable real property in the City, or areas served by the City for emergency <br />services. (Added, Ord. 822, 7-2-09) <br /> <br />Subd. 3. Collection of Unpaid Service Charges and Fees. If the City is authorized to impose <br />a service charge or fee on the owner, lessee, or occupant of property, or any of them, for a <br />governmental service provided by the City, the City may certify to the County Auditor, <br />on or before October 15 for each year, any unpaid service charges or fees which shall <br />then be collected together with property taxes levied against the property. A charge or <br />fee may be certified to the Auditor only if, on or before September 15, the City has given <br />written notice to the property owner of its intention to certify the charge or fee to the <br />Auditor. The service charges or fees shall be subject to the same penalties, interest, and <br />other conditions provided for the collection of property taxes. This Section is in addition <br />to any other law authorizing the collection of unpaid costs and service charges or fees. <br />(Added, Ord. 822, 7-2-09) <br /> <br /> <br />City of Mounds View
